当前位置:首页 > 综合资讯 > 正文
黑狐家游戏

对象存储架构图,对象存储技术架构解析与深入探讨

对象存储架构图,对象存储技术架构解析与深入探讨

该架构图展示了对象存储系统的整体结构,包括客户端、REST API服务器、元数据服务器和存储节点等组成部分,客户端通过HTTP/HTTPS协议向REST API服务器发...

该架构图展示了对象存储系统的整体结构,包括客户端、REST API服务器、元数据服务器和存储节点等组成部分,客户端通过HTTP/HTTPS协议向REST API服务器发送请求,API服务器负责处理请求并将数据转发给相应的元数据服务器或存储节点,元数据服务器用于管理数据的元信息,如文件名、大小、创建时间等,而存储节点则负责实际的数据存储和读取操作,整个系统采用分布式设计,确保了高可用性和可扩展性。

随着数据量的爆炸式增长和云计算技术的不断发展,传统的文件存储方式已经无法满足现代企业的需求,对象存储作为一种新兴的数据存储解决方案,以其高扩展性、低成本和高可靠性等特点逐渐成为企业级数据存储的首选,本文将围绕对象存储技术架构进行详细剖析,并结合实际案例进行分析。

对象存储架构图,对象存储技术架构解析与深入探讨

图片来源于网络,如有侵权联系删除

近年来,随着互联网、物联网等技术的发展,数据的产生速度和处理量呈现出指数级的增长趋势,传统的关系型数据库已难以应对这种海量数据处理的需求,一种新的数据存储模式——对象存储应运而生,它不仅能够高效地处理大量非结构化数据,还能实现数据的快速访问和备份恢复等功能。

对象存储概述

1 定义与特点

对象存储是一种以对象为单位进行存储和管理的数据存储技术,每个对象都由唯一标识符(ID)来区分,并且可以包含任意类型的数据,相比传统的块存储或文件系统,对象存储具有以下显著优势:

  • 高度可扩展性:支持无限数量的对象存储,无需担心容量限制;
  • 弹性计算:可以根据业务需求动态调整资源分配,实现按需付费;
  • 持久性:采用多副本机制确保数据的高可用性和容错能力;
  • 安全性:通过加密等技术手段保障数据的安全性;

2 工作原理

对象存储的核心思想是将数据划分为一个个独立的对象单元,然后对这些对象进行统一的管理和维护,当客户端向服务器发送请求时,服务器会根据请求内容生成相应的响应信息并发送给客户端,整个过程中,服务器负责接收和处理来自不同来源的各种请求,而客户端则负责发起这些请求并进行后续操作。

对象存储关键技术点分析

1 分布式文件系统设计

分布式文件系统是构建在计算机网络之上的虚拟文件系统,它允许多个节点共同管理和共享同一份数据集,在设计分布式文件系统时需要考虑以下几个关键因素:

  • 一致性:所有节点的视图应该保持一致,即无论从哪个节点读取数据都应该得到相同的结果;
  • 可用性:系统能够持续提供服务的能力,即使某些节点出现故障也不会影响整体性能;
  • 分区容忍性:在网络延迟较高或者网络拓扑发生变化的情况下仍然能够正常运行;

2 数据分片与复制策略

为了提高系统的可靠性和可扩展性,通常会采用数据分片和数据复制的策略,数据分片是指将原始数据进行分割成若干个小片段的过程,然后将这些小片段分散到不同的物理位置上存放;而数据复制则是为了保证某个特定位置的副本失效后不会导致整个系统瘫痪,从而采取的一种预防措施。

3 存储介质选择与管理

在选择合适的存储介质时需要综合考虑多种因素,如成本、读写速度、耐用性等,常见的存储介质有硬盘驱动器(HDD)、固态硬盘(SSD)以及云盘服务等,还需要关注如何有效地管理这些存储设备以确保其稳定运行。

对象存储架构图,对象存储技术架构解析与深入探讨

图片来源于网络,如有侵权联系删除

4 安全性与隐私保护

随着网络安全威胁的不断升级,如何在保证数据安全的同时又不牺牲用户体验成为了摆在开发者面前的一道难题,为此,我们可以引入一系列的安全技术和手段来增强系统的防护能力,例如身份验证、访问控制、数据加密以及监控预警等。

案例分析

1 案例一:某大型电商平台的对象存储实践

该电商平台采用了自研的对象存储解决方案来支撑其业务的快速发展,通过对海量商品图片、视频等内容进行有效的组织和分发,极大地提升了用户的购物体验,他们还利用大数据分析技术对用户行为进行深度挖掘,以便更好地制定营销策略和提高客户满意度。

2 案例二:某金融机构的数据备份方案

这家金融机构面临着巨大的数据量和复杂的业务场景,因此需要一个高性能且稳定的存储解决方案来应对挑战,经过多方比较和研究后,最终选择了对象存储作为核心架构之一,这不仅解决了原有的性能瓶颈问题,而且还实现了跨地域的数据同步和灾难恢复功能。

结论与展望

对象存储凭借其独特的优势和强大的实用性已经成为当今数据中心不可或缺的一部分,我们也应该看到当前仍存在一些亟待解决的问题,比如如何进一步提高系统的效率和可靠性?又或者是怎样更好地平衡成本与性能之间的关系呢?这些问题都需要我们在未来的实践中不断探索和创新来解决。

展望未来,随着5G时代的到来和各种新技术的涌现,相信对象存储将会迎来更加广阔的发展空间和应用前景,届时,我们有望看到一个更加智能、高效且安全的数字世界出现在我们的眼前!

黑狐家游戏

发表评论

最新文章